Software Development Engineer Ii

Expedia,

Springfield, MissouriFull-timeMid LevelOn-site

Job Description

Software Development Engineer II In this role, you will: Develop and test standard software applications and related programs and procedures to ensure they meet design requirements. Apply standard methods to design, develop, debug, and modify components of software applications and tools. Complete tasks and/or provide data to support implementation of solutions. Apply software design principles, data structures and design patterns, and computer science fundamentals to write code that is clean, maintainable, optimized, modular with good naming conventions. Report clearly on current work status. Work on a project supplying business partners with customized hotel deals to provide the business with growth in the Merchandising market. Develop Java REST APIs for travel partners. Work with AWS cloud services, create ETLs for data ingestion, and develop UI using React and other front‑end technologies. This position is not eligible for relocation benefits or assistance. May work remotely or from home 2 days/week; must live within commuting distance of the Expedia office. Experience and qualifications: Master’s degree in Computer Science, Engineering, or a related field and 2 years of experience in the job offered or in a Software Development Engineer‑related occupation. Front‑end web development principles with React, HTML, and CSS. REST API Development with SpringBoot. Building and deploying complex software products with Git, Docker, and continuous integration/continuous deployment (CI/CD). SQL, PostgreSQL, or other data query languages. Java, Python, and JavaScript. AWS or other cloud computing frameworks. Working in agile software development processes. Machine Learning infrastructure and libraries such as NumPy, Pandas, or Matplotlib. The total cash range for this position in Springfield, MO is $94,500 to $151,000 per year. Starting pay for this role will vary based on multiple factors, including location, available budget, and an individual’s knowledge, skills, and experience. Pay ranges may be modified in the future. Accommodation requests If you need assistance with any part of the application or recruiting process due to a disability or other physical or mental health conditions, please reach out to our Recruiting Accommodations Team through the Accommodation Request. Expedia is committed to creating an inclusive work environment with a diverse workforce.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. This employer participates in E‑Verify. The employer will provide the Social Security Administration (SSA) and, if necessary, the Department of Homeland Security (DHS) with information from each new employee’s I‑9 to confirm work authorization. #J-18808-Ljbffr

Posted Today

Related Jobs

Software Engineer

SHI GmbH

Raleigh, North Carolina Today
Full-time On-site Mid Level Technology

Related Searches